Viemed Healthcare, Inc. (NASDAQ:VMD – Get Free Report) insider William Frazier sold 10,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Thursday, June 25th. The stock was sold at an average price of $11.72, for a total transaction of $117,200.00. Following the sale, the insider owned 73,214 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$858,068.08. This represents a 12.02% decrease in their position. Viemed Healthcare Stock Performance
Shares of VMD stock opened at $11.63 on Friday. The company has a market capitalization of $445.89 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 31.43 and a beta of 1.12.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.06, a quick ratio of 1.10 and a current ratio of 1.22. The company has a 50-day simple moving average of $9.91 and a 200 day simple moving average of $8.84. Viemed Healthcare, Inc. has a 52 week low of $5.93 and a 52 week high of $11.88.
Viemed Healthcare (NASDAQ:VMD –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, May 5th. The company reported $0.06 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.09 by ($0.03). The company had revenue of $75.41 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$74.40 million. Viemed Healthcare had a net margin of 5.20% and a return on equity of 10.52%. On average, sell-side analysts predict that Viemed Healthcare, Inc. will post 0.44 earnings per share for the current year.

About Viemed Healthcare
Viemed Healthcare, Inc (NASDAQ: VMD) is a provider of home-based respiratory therapy services, specializing in the management of patients requiring long-term mechanical ventilation and pulmonary support. The company’s offerings encompass invasive and noninvasive ventilation, airway clearance therapies, cough assist devices, and supplemental oxygen. Viemed combines durable medical equipment with clinical care, delivering tailored respiratory treatment plans that are overseen by licensed respiratory therapists and registered nurses.
Founded in the early 2010s and headquartered in Birmingham, Alabama, Viemed has grown its footprint to serve patients across multiple states in the United States.
